**About the role**
The NSW Aboriginal Cultural Advisor position is a newly created role within Lifestyle Solutions that will work along service delivery teams to ensure that Aboriginal Children and Young People receive Culturally Safe care and support.
The role of the NSW Aboriginal Cultural Advisor is to:
- Contribute to the provision and quality of culturally sensitive and responsive services, and a culturally safe working environment through consultation and engagement with Lifestyle Solutions team members, Aboriginal Peoples and relevant Aboriginal Community Controlled Organisations (ACCO's)
- Continually support and refine cultural planning process
- Provide guidance to teams on culturally appropriate ways of working with children and young people we support who identify as being of Aboriginal and/or Torres Strait Islander descent
- Support capability via cultural reflection and coaching of staff undertaking planning and contributing to any training resources developed in support of this key function
- Supporting the development of cultural plans, including supporting contact / connections with kin, community, and stakeholders, and where required contributing to plan development
**About you**
The successful applicant will have the following skills and experience:
- Identify as Aboriginal with cultural competency required to undertake this role
- Knowledge of issues impacting Aboriginal and Torres Strait Islander (ATSI) people and communities in the context of family
- Knowledge and or lived experience on the issues impacting ATSI children and young people residing in statutory out of home care
- Knowledge and or lived experience around the social determinates of health impacting on ATSI people
- Current Driving Licence
- Comprehensive understanding of culturally appropriate contemporary engagement with ATSI families
- Extensive knowledge of issues impacting on Aboriginal people and communities in contemporary society Ability to communicate effectively and sensitively with ATSI people
- Demonstrated experience in Networking and stakeholder engagement
- Demonstrated experience in leading small projects within community
- Strong communication skills both spoken and written, with the ability to adapt communication styles depending on the setting
